Active Shooter and Large Scale Incidents – A Civilian Response
The goal of this presentation is to educate the general public on various active shooter situations we have had in the United States, in addition to large scale incidents which have involved both shooting and IED events. The presentation will give case studies of various shooting incidents and the lessons learned, both by Law Enforcement and the individuals who were victims in the event. The goal is to prepare individuals and get them thinking about how they can better protect themselves if they should find themselves in such a situation. Participants will have a better understanding of the Law Enforcement response and hear from actual survivors from active shooter events.
